How they compare

Croatia currently reports 10.28 % against 10.12 % in Dominican Republic, a difference of 0.16 %.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 32 shared years of data; in 1992 it was Croatia ahead.

Croatia ranks 37th and Dominican Republic ranks 40th of 208 countries.

Croatia has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Croatia Dominican Republic Difference Ahead
1990s 10.38 % 5.01 % 5.36 % Croatia
2000s 10.81 % 6.84 % 3.97 % Croatia
2010s 13.61 % 7.93 % 5.68 % Croatia
2020s 13.12 % 9.71 % 3.41 % Croatia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ions indicators disseminates indicators on sectoral shares of total national gre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ions as well as three indicators of emissions intensity: per capita emissions; emissions per value of agricultural production; and emissions per area of agricultural land.
